Gophers Trounce Terrapins in Three

11/11/2022 8:20:00 PM | Volleyball

Minnesota has won 10 of its last 12 matches

MINNEAPOLIS -- The No. 9 Minnesota Golden Gophers volleyball team defeated the Maryland Terrapins in three sets, 25-12, 25-13, 25-16 on Friday night at Maturi Pavilion.

With the win, the Gophers have won 10 of their last 12 matches overall with five left to play in 2022. They'll finish off their Big Ten home slate Sunday vs. Indiana.

Taylor Landfair led Minnesota with 11 kills while Jenna Wenaas had nine kills and 12 digs. Melani Shaffmaster posted double-double No. 12 of the year with 30 assists and 16 digs while Carter Booth had nine kills and three blocks.



As a team, Minnesota (16-7, 11-4 Big Ten) hit .287 with 39 kills, six team blocks, 55 digs and seven aces. Maryland (14-13, 5-10 Big Ten) hit .043 with 27 kills, four team blocks, 46 digs and three aces.

Gem Grimshaw and Laila Ivey led Maryland with six kills.

Set Breakdown:
Set 1: Minnesota started out red hot, scoring nine of the first 12 points to take a six-point lead, forcing a Maryland timeout.Taylor Landfair had three early kills while Jenna Wenaas tallied two and Carter Booth had one. The Terps would get it back within five at 10-5 before two more kills from Wenaas and a Maryland attacking error made it 13-5 Gophers, forcing Maryland's second timeout. The Terps would cut the lead to six at 14-8 but would get no closer, as Minnesota finished the set on an 11-4 run to win, 25-12. The Gophers hit .341 in set one, getting seven kills and four digs from Wenaas, four kills from Booth and Landfair and eight digs from CC McGraw.

Set 2: The Gophers picked up where they left off in set one, scoring six of the first eight in set two to go up 6-2. Booth and Lauren Crowl had a block while Landfair had a pair of kills in the spurt. Minnesota would go up six at 11-5 after an ace from McGraw and a block from Crowl and Arica Davis. The Terps would fight back, however, going on a 4-0 run with a pair of kills and an ace to cut the lead to 11-9. The 'U' refused to allow the score to get any closer, scoring six of the next eight to go up 17-11. Crowl, Davis and Melani Shaffmaster posted kills and Rachel Kilkelly had an ace, causing a Maryland timeout. The Gophers kept it going after the break, capping off a 9-0 run to go up 23-11. Kilkelly had three more aces while Booth had a solo block and Crowl tallied another kill. The 'U' would finish off the set, 25-13, going up 2-0.

Set 3: Minnesota scored five of the first seven, going up 5-2 on the back of a pair of kills from Booth, one from Shaffmaster and an ace from Kilkelly. After another UMD point, the 'U' reeled off four straight, getting three attacking errors and a kill from Davis to go up 9-3, forcing a Maryland timeout. Two UMD kills made it 9-5 before a Landfair kill and Wenaas ace helped balloon the lead up to eight at 13-5. Another Landfair kill got her to double-figures for the 23rd straight game before Kilkelly's season-best fourth ace of the night put Minnesota up nine, 16-7, forcing another Maryland timeout. A 3-0 Terps run got it to 16-10 before a 5-1 Gophers spurt put the set out of reach at 21-11. Landfair posted two more kills while Booth and Wenaas had one each. Minnesota closed out set three, 25-16, to earn the sweep.

Notable:
-Minnesota moves to 15-0 all-time against Maryland with the win.
-CC McGraw (12) tallied her 99th career 10+ dig outing, including her 14th this season. She's now up to 1,821 for her career, just 49 behind Dalianliz Rosado for the No. 3 spot in Minnesota laurels.
-Melani Shaffmaster posted 30 assists and 16 digs, her Big Ten-leading 12th double double this season.
-Taylor Landfair (11) totaled double digit kills for the 23rd time this season and 41st time in her career. She's the only Power Five player in the country to have double digit kills in every match.
-Carter Booth nine kills, her seventh straight game with seven-or-more.
-Rachel Kilkelly tallied 10 digs, her fifth 10+ dig match of 2022, and fourth consecutive.
-Kilkelly also had four aces (season-high), her second 3+ ace match of the year and sixth of her career.
-The Gophers held Maryland to just .043 hitting, a season-worst for a Minnesota opponent.
